Get Office Free as a Student or TeacherMany educational institutions pay for Office 365 plans, allowing students and teachers to download the software for free.To find out if your school participates, head to the Office 365 Education website, and enter your school email address. You might be able to take advantage of both offers for two months of free Microsoft Office access. They’ll each get access to the apps via their Microsoft account, and will have their own 1TB of storage for a combined 6TB of storage.Microsoft also offers free 30-day evaluations of Office 365 ProPlus, which is intended for businesses. You’ll need a paid subscription to get document-editing capabilities an iPad Pro or newer 10.2-inch iPads. On an iPhone or Android phone, you can download the Office mobile apps to open, create, and edit documents for free.On an iPad or Android tablet, these apps will only let you create and edit documents if you have a “device with a screen size smaller than 10.1 inches.” On a larger tablet, you can install these apps to view documents, but you’ll need a paid subscription to create and edit them.In practice, this means Word, Excel, and PowerPoint offer a full experience for free on the iPad Mini and older 9.7-inch iPads.
